WELCOME TO CASTLE ROCK
We are a church community that is real, messy, and new. That means wherever you are in your faith journey, we’d love to meet you!
Castle Rock is our newest campus. We launched out of Douglas County High School on Easter 2024, and we’re thrilled to be in our new, permanent location as of October 2025. Our weekend services feature live worship and Craig’s teaching via video stream.
At Mission Hills, we exist to help people become like Jesus and join him on mission, and we’d love to help you take your next step. Stop by the Welcome Center to get started.
JOINING US WITH KIDS OR STUDENTS?
KIDS MINISTRY
Kids Ministry is available for birth – 5th grade. If you are a first-time guest, we have reserved parking for you by the South Entrance. Once inside, head to the Kids Check-In Desk in the South Lobby to get started.
Save time at check-in for your first visit by pre-registering your family. Click below to get started.
STUDENT MINISTRY
Student Ministry meets on Sundays at 9:15 AM. Middle School + High School Students, meet upstairs in The Loft. We’ll sit together during worship, then have small group time during the sermon.

Meet Our Campus Pastor
Tanner Lowe
Hi, I’m Tanner Lowe, the Campus Pastor for our Castle Rock campus. I am passionate about empowering people to embrace God’s love and purpose for their lives. I have a Master of Divinity from Duke Divinity School with an emphasis in Biblical languages.
I am honored to have a front row seat to what God is doing in Castle Rock and at our Mission Hills Castle Rock campus as people take steps to follow Jesus and reach this community. My wife Whitney and I live in Castle Rock with kids Judah, Thea, and Shepherd.
